Wolwark [ˈvɔlvark]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Szubin, within Nakło County, Kuyavian-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-central Poland.[1] It lies approximately 5 kilometres (3 mi) south-west of Szubin, 19 km (12 mi) south of Nakło nad Notecią, and 25 km (16 mi) south-west of Bydgoszcz.
The village has a population of 289.
